Output 5ffd80e1e8a3c2228d5a6fed7d9b660e9637bda0e88269845905d4e15e6e26cd:1

value
2409640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61b95d9bbb78254968d0bd2ddc331273f5b4733d OP_EQUAL
address
3AbjXamQPfiBdNjDS5BrSweYLRyB6sWrab
transaction
5ffd80e1e8a3c2228d5a6fed7d9b660e9637bda0e88269845905d4e15e6e26cd
confirmations
319083
spent
true